Xen Posted May 23, 2018 Posted May 23, 2018 1 hour ago, Murieleirum said: You are making me crave it and I don't even know anything about her choreographing abilities! Will you link something to this poor ignorant fs newbie? c: Um, Mao Asada, Sochi 2014, Rach 2 Long. Mao 2010 Vancouver, Bells of Moscow LP are probably iconic ones from her. Sasha Cohen, 2003-2004 both SP and LP (Malaguena and Swan Lake)-both pretty iconic Sasha Cohen programs. I think for men, I only recall her choreographing for Alexei Yagudin (his more iconic ones such as Winter and Man in the Iron Mask). Johnny Weir's SP and LP from 2004-2006.
